What does business Ethernet cost in New Orleans?

New Orleans Ethernet pricing scales with bandwidth, the number of sites, and term. Lower tiers run a few hundred a month, while multi-gig or multi-site designs cost more, and competing New Orleans bids pin down the rate.

Can one Ethernet circuit give internet access?

Yes. Dedicated Ethernet access gives a New Orleans site symmetrical bandwidth with a hard SLA, and the same technology builds private links between locations.

How scalable is New Orleans Ethernet?

Very. A New Orleans Ethernet service typically scales in fine steps from 10 Mbps to 10 Gbps, often without new hardware, so bandwidth grows with the business.

Ethernet or MPLS for a New Orleans network?

Ethernet offers high, symmetrical bandwidth and simple scaling for New Orleans site-to-site connectivity, while MPLS adds class-of-service routing. Many networks combine them or pair Ethernet with SD-WAN.

What is business Ethernet?

Business Ethernet is carrier-grade, fiber-based connectivity delivering symmetrical, scalable bandwidth from 10 Mbps to 10 Gbps, used for dedicated internet access or private site-to-site links in New Orleans.

How long is Ethernet install in New Orleans?

If fiber already serves the New Orleans buildings, install can take a few weeks; new construction takes longer. Carriers confirm timelines in their bids.
